Transaction feeaf885154e25dabaa92cf9216aef0d3f5890ee8f12dae27aa5942c1859be3a
1 Input
1 Output
-
feeaf885154e25dabaa92cf9216aef0d3f5890ee8f12dae27aa5942c1859be3a:0
- value
- 90892
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 6e171c59b6ab72ea62b06574254b22af4890d04a94edc88bb6fd189c936461b5
- address
- bc1pdct3ckdk4dew5c4sv46z2jez4ayfp5z2jnku3zakl5vfeymyvx6sc7pn0t